Transaction 167461eb84b06aaf37a5f4bb9dd984b5b00da6fdbb1810dd9fffa497e1593d4f

2 Input
1 Outputs
  • 167461eb84b06aaf37a5f4bb9dd984b5b00da6fdbb1810dd9fffa497e1593d4f:0
  • value  75070346
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u